> Did you run that from within UC Davis? There is quite a number of academic 
> networks that subscribe to the "if we filter out ICMP at the network border 
> we can't be hacked" fallacy. A better test would be:
>
>
> $ ssh g...@trac.sagemath.org <javascript:>
> PTY allocation request failed on channel 0
> hello vbraun, this is git@trac running gitolite3 3.5.3.1-2 (Debian) on git 
> 1.9.1
>
>  R W gitolite-admin
>  R W sage
> Connection to trac.sagemath.org closed.
>
>
> PS: the github url is for releases, so if you want to work on tickets you 
> need to be able to connect to trac...
